Yes another vibes thread, but unlike most of these... I feel like I have mostly dotted my i's and crossed my t's. Getting vibes around 40mph on up.

2004 TJ with a 4" currie lift. I have an SYE and double cardan. I got the front end dialed in using Nate's YouTube video on using lasers and whatnot to get everything centered. Jeep steering feels better than it ever has.

Toe is at 1/16". I ended up pulling the front driveshaft to make sure I wasn't feeling vibes from the wrong area.

Caster is at 5.5 degrees.

Rear double cardan driveshaft is at 17.5 and pinion is at 16.5 degrees - verified with digital angle finder. Have messed around between set equal to each other and as far as the pinion 2 degrees lower in .5 degree increments.

Ran the Jeep today on jack stands with my cellphone on a tripod below. Can feel slight vibes around the same parameters but not the same as being on pavement. Video was no help in locating anything.

At this point my mind went to either wheel bearings or motor mounts. Checked for play in the wheel bearings and they seem fine.
I went with LJ rear springs and TJ heavy duty fronts, so without any heavy weight in bumpers and a winch it seems my lift is around 5" true. Where is the next logical place to look? I know if I do a MML and body lift I would be reducing the tcase by around +/- 3 degrees?

Could be either or both. Spinning caps wear away the tabs that keep the joint centered. Pinion angle vibes are present either on acceleration or deceleration depending on if high or low. Balance vibes will occur in a rpm(speed) range say 45-55 mph. Vibes that start and stay more often than not indicate loose or worn parts.
